Excuse my ignorance but, do we need to be 100% finished before the security review can happen? Although it has not been officially been documented within our Security Readiness Review SOP <https://www.mediawiki.org/wiki/Security/SOP/Security_Readiness_Reviews>, we typically ask code owners to select a "stopping point" for a review. This is ideally (a) commit sha(s) where the code is as close to production-ready as it can be so that we do not have to review a volatile codebase which may change substantially within a few days. Our team simply does not have the resources and sanity to conduct numerous reviews of volatile code. We understand this may not be possible in certain situations and that small changes (i18n, doc, etc.) can occur with little overall impact, but we strive to have the code in a stable, finished state prior to our reviews.
